Tharsus drives agritech innovation
The Engineer reports on agritech start-up and Tharsus partner The Small Robot Company’s latest developments. The company’s robot, named Dick, is the world’s first non-chemical robotic weeding system for cereal crops and recently completed its first set of successful field trials.

Investment for Blyth to power innovation
It has been announced that Blyth has been awarded nearly £21 million Government funding to boost regeneration. The £20.9 million investment is part of the £70 million Energising Blyth programme which aims to transform Blyth into a thriving centre of renewable energy and advanced manufacturing innovation by 2030.

Tharsus brings Connect-R robotics project to life
We are proud to announce that Tharsus acted as consultants on the launch of Connect-R – a world-first modular robot specifically designed to build emergency structures in the planet’s most hazardous environments and remove humans from harm.
